Output 691c8cd4e4c9c0f8a68551fd58aff729ecd3e812838908ab4c44fdaa48cb0157:57

value
167507
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ffab03f8bc402474cb010304e367af45bd13a35f OP_EQUAL
address
3Qzs6puRhDuoQ5ESte7KLgHerMkQXvUYsY
transaction
691c8cd4e4c9c0f8a68551fd58aff729ecd3e812838908ab4c44fdaa48cb0157
spent
true